What is spank?

Spank is a Go app for Apple Silicon MacBooks (M2+) that taps the built-in accelerometer via IOKit HID to detect physical slaps on the laptop back, then yells back with embedded audio clips. Run `sudo spank` for default pain mode ("ow!" sounds) or `sudo spank --sexy` for escalating responses based on slap frequency over a 5-minute windowโ€”up to 60 intensity levels. It's a single binary desk toy solving boredom, turning your MacBook into a reactive prank machine with no extra dependencies.

Why is it gaining traction?

Dev quotes in the README capture the hook: pure, dumb fun that has folks "dying laughing," even in sexy mode next to family. Stands out from sensor gimmicks with dead-simple CLI, instant audio feedback on slap detection (STA/LTA, kurtosis peaks), and a 500ms cooldown to avoid spam.
